Xiaochong Zhang is a scholar working on Molecular Biology, Pulmonary and Respiratory Medicine and Oncology. According to data from OpenAlex, Xiaochong Zhang has authored 32 papers receiving a total of 515 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 6 papers in Pulmonary and Respiratory Medicine and 6 papers in Oncology. Recurrent topics in Xiaochong Zhang's work include MicroRNA in disease regulation (3 papers), Cancer Immunotherapy and Biomarkers (3 papers) and Soil Carbon and Nitrogen Dynamics (3 papers). Xiaochong Zhang is often cited by papers focused on MicroRNA in disease regulation (3 papers), Cancer Immunotherapy and Biomarkers (3 papers) and Soil Carbon and Nitrogen Dynamics (3 papers). Xiaochong Zhang collaborates with scholars based in China, Netherlands and Moldova. Xiaochong Zhang's co-authors include Meixiang Sang, Lina Gu, Lingjiao Meng, Yingchao Ju, Fei Liu, Yishui Lian, Yunyan Wu, Yang Sang, Ping’an Ding and Baoen Shan and has published in prestigious journals such as The Science of The Total Environment, Gut and Soil Biology and Biochemistry.
